Transaction a18d93b821d99e19865e14e2f2872af5532e0b76837dd9d3fad85f7f984e4b1a

2 Input
1 Outputs
  • a18d93b821d99e19865e14e2f2872af5532e0b76837dd9d3fad85f7f984e4b1a:0
  • value  2057962
    address  12PTfnXSSsc4fDVY7J22PGLD1UyXFvMEBB